重庆金属有限公司

软件开发 ·
首页 / 资讯 / 电商平台Web系统开发周期揭秘:影响因素与优化策略

电商平台Web系统开发周期揭秘:影响因素与优化策略

电商平台Web系统开发周期揭秘:影响因素与优化策略
软件开发 电商平台web系统开发周期多久 发布:2026-06-11

电商平台Web系统开发周期揭秘:影响因素与优化策略

一、项目背景与需求分析

电商平台Web系统的开发周期受到多种因素的影响,首先需要明确的是项目背景和需求分析。一个电商平台Web系统的开发,通常需要从以下几个方面进行需求分析:

1. 商业模式:了解电商平台的商业模式,包括产品种类、销售渠道、用户群体等。 2. 功能需求:明确电商平台的核心功能,如商品展示、购物车、订单管理、支付系统等。 3. 性能需求:根据业务规模和预期用户量,确定系统的性能指标,如响应时间、并发处理能力等。 4. 安全需求:确保电商平台的数据安全,包括用户信息、交易信息等。

二、技术选型与架构设计

技术选型和架构设计是影响开发周期的关键因素。以下是一些常见的技术选型和架构设计要点:

1. 技术栈:选择合适的技术栈,如前端框架(React、Vue等)、后端框架(Spring Boot、Django等)、数据库(MySQL、MongoDB等)。 2. 架构模式:采用微服务架构、领域驱动设计(DDD)等先进架构模式,提高系统的可扩展性和可维护性。 3. DevOps实践:引入CI/CD流水线,实现自动化部署和持续集成,提高开发效率。

三、开发与测试

开发与测试阶段是整个项目周期中耗时最长的部分。以下是一些优化开发与测试的策略:

1. 代码质量:遵循编码规范,进行单元测试、集成测试和性能测试,确保代码质量。 2. 代码重构:定期进行代码重构,提高代码的可读性和可维护性。 3. 异步解耦:采用消息队列、事件溯源等技术,实现系统间的异步解耦,提高系统的稳定性和可扩展性。

四、上线与运维

上线与运维阶段是保证电商平台Web系统稳定运行的关键。以下是一些运维要点:

1. 监控与报警:实时监控系统性能,及时发现并处理异常情况。 2. 灾难恢复:制定应急预案,确保在发生故障时能够快速恢复系统。 3. 持续优化:根据用户反馈和业务需求,不断优化系统性能和功能。

总结

电商平台Web系统的开发周期受多种因素影响,包括项目背景、技术选型、开发与测试、上线与运维等。通过合理的技术选型、高效的开发与测试流程以及完善的运维策略,可以缩短开发周期,提高系统质量。本文实践来自某团队近期参与的某电商平台微服务拆分项目,具体方案可进一步交流。

本文由 重庆金属有限公司 整理发布。

更多软件开发文章

医疗行业手机应用定制开发:价格背后的考量因素软件开发公司报价单:揭秘背后的考量因素小程序开发中参数配置错误的排查之道广州公众号开发费用明细:揭秘成本构成与优化策略**企业小程序开发流程包括需求分析、设计、开发、测试、上线等环节。以下是一些关键点:H5开发小程序,这五大注意事项你不得不看**OA系统开发:厂家直供,价格之外的关键考量小程序开发费用明细:揭秘成本构成与优化策略**小程序定制开发:价格背后的考量因素如何与上海小程序开发公司合作?四大关键点解析软件定制开发公司资质解析:合规之路的关键要素定制开发与模板开发:App开发的两种路径解析
友情链接: 徐州网络科技有限公司长沙科技有限公司科技浙江科技有限公司查看详情本地服务瑞和财税有限公司推荐链接农业生态